Is it obligatory to wash the hands upon waking up, and how many times? Does this include sleep at night and any [other] sleep? Is it obligatory or recommended? And does whatever the hand touches before washing become impure?
The hadith (When one of you wakes from his sleep, he should not dip his hand into the vessel until he has washed it three times, for he does not know where his hand spent the night) is authentic. It is permissible to wash the hands two or three times upon waking from sleep at night. This ruling is general for both night and day sleep according to the majority of scholars, while Ahmad and Dawud restricted it to night sleep. Washing the hands three times after waking from night sleep is recommended, not obligatory, according to the majority of scholars. Therefore, whoever deviates from this does not commit a sin, nor is the water or the touched item judged impure.
